I am new to react. I have never in my life worked with assigning roles and permissions while authorizing user. Can anyone help me with a resource that can help a newbie understand role based authorization? My core requirement is how it is done and through that i want to show/hide buttons in the component on the basis of roles assigned to the user. Thanks!